The New Frontier: Guidelines of Web3 Development and Web3 Security - Points To Understand

When it comes to the quickly changing landscape of online digital style, we are observing a fundamental relocation far from central silos toward a extra open, user-centric web. This evolution, commonly labelled the decentralized web, is not simply a change in just how we save information, however a total reimagining of just how trust is developed in between events who do not know each other. At the heart of this change lie 2 important columns: the technological implementation of decentralized systems and the rigorous defense of the possessions and data within them.Understanding the Change in Online digital ArchitectureFor years, the web operated on a client-server model. In this arrangement, a central authority-- normally a huge firm-- managed the web servers, owned the data, and determined the rules of interaction. While effective, this version created single points of failure and put tremendous power in the hands of a few.The shift to a decentralized structure adjustments this vibrant by distributing information across a network of independent nodes. Instead of depending on a central database, applications now utilize distributed journals to make sure openness and immutability. This shift requires a brand-new approach to building software program, concentrating on reasoning that is carried out by the network itself rather than a private server.Core Concepts of Web3 DevelopmentBuilding for the decentralized internet needs a departure from conventional software design frame of minds. Designers should represent atmospheres where code, once deployed, is often permanent and where individuals communicate with services through online digital signatures instead of usernames and passwords.Logic through Smart Dealings: The engine of any kind of decentralized application is the clever contract. These are self-executing scripts with the regards to the agreement straight created right into lines of code. They automate processes-- such as the transfer of a online digital deed or the confirmation of a credential-- without the requirement for a human intermediary.Interoperability and Open up Specifications: Unlike the "walled yards" of the past, contemporary decentralized growth emphasizes modularity. Applications are developed to "talk" to each other, allowing developers to connect into existing identity protocols or storage space solutions as opposed to developing them from scratch.User Sovereignty: A main goal of advancement is to ensure that users keep possession of their details. Rather than "logging in" to a website that gathers their information, customers "connect" to an user interface, Web3 Development approving it short-term permission to communicate with their digital vault.The Essential Duty of Web3 SecurityIn a world where code is regulation and purchases are irreversible, the margin for error is non-existent. Typical internet protection frequently relies upon "patching" susceptabilities after they are uncovered. In a decentralized setting, a single problem in a wise agreement can result in the long-term loss of digital assets prior to a solution can even be proposed .1. Unalterable VulnerabilitiesThe greatest stamina of a dispersed ledger-- its immutability-- is additionally its best safety obstacle. If a designer deploys a agreement with a reasoning error, that error is etched right into the system. Top-level protection currently includes " Official Confirmation," a procedure where mathematical proofs are utilized to guarantee that the code acts precisely as planned under every feasible circumstance .2. The Principle of Least PrivilegeEffective safety and security strategies now focus on decreasing the "blast span" of a potential compromise. By utilizing multi-signature methods-- where several independent celebrations have to accept a high-stakes activity-- designers make certain that no single compromised key can trigger a total system failing .3. Bookkeeping and Constant MonitoringSecurity is no more a "one-and-done" checklist. It is a constant lifecycle. Professional advancement teams now use: Outside Audits: Third-party professionals that "stress-test" code prior to it goes live.Real-time On-chain Monitoring: Automated devices that scan for dubious patterns in network task, allowing for "circuit breakers" to stop a system if an attack is detected.Looking Ahead: A Trustless FutureThe trip towards a decentralized web is still in its onset. As tools for development come to be more obtainable and security frameworks much more durable, we will certainly see these technologies move past niche applications into the mainstream. From supply chain openness to the safe and secure monitoring of medical records, the fusion of decentralized logic and uncompromising safety is setting the stage for a much more equitable digital world.The focus is moving away from the hype of brand-new technologies and toward the real energy they provide: a internet where personal privacy is the default, and depend on is developed into the very code we make use of daily.
